Why Consider Telepractice for Speech Therapy?
Data supports the efficacy of telepractice in delivering speech therapy to children. According to a study published in the Journal of Speech, Language, and Hearing Research, children receiving online speech therapy services demonstrated similar, if not superior, progress compared to their peers receiving traditional face-to-face therapy. This finding is pivotal, especially when considering the accessibility and flexibility that telepractice offers.
Here are some compelling reasons why technology-driven speech therapy is a game-changer:
- Accessibility: Telepractice breaks down geographical barriers, making it possible for children in remote or underserved areas to receive high-quality speech therapy services.
- Consistency: With online sessions, therapy can continue uninterrupted, regardless of weather conditions or transportation issues, ensuring consistent progress.
- Engagement: Many digital platforms used for telepractice incorporate interactive elements that can make sessions more engaging for children, thereby enhancing learning and retention.
- Data-Driven Decisions: Online platforms often provide detailed analytics and progress tracking, allowing therapists to make informed, data-driven decisions tailored to each child's unique needs.
Implementing Telepractice in Schools
Implementing telepractice in schools requires careful planning and collaboration between school counselors, teachers, parents, and therapy providers. Here are steps to consider when integrating online speech therapy into your school's support services:
- Assess Needs: Begin by assessing the specific speech therapy needs within your school community. This will help in tailoring services that best fit the student population.
- Choose the Right Provider: Partner with a reputable telepractice provider, such as TinyEYE, that has a proven track record of success and offers customizable therapy solutions.
- Ensure Technological Readiness: Ensure that your school's technological infrastructure can support online therapy sessions, including reliable internet access and appropriate devices.
- Engage Stakeholders: Involve parents, teachers, and other stakeholders in the planning process to ensure a supportive and collaborative environment for the students.
- Monitor and Evaluate: Regularly monitor the progress of students receiving telepractice services and evaluate the effectiveness of the program to make necessary adjustments.
